The Local Government Ethics Law requires newly elected and appointed local government officers to file a financial disclosure statement within 30 days of taking office.  However the Division is finalizing the FDS filing process for 2014 and forms cannot be officially completed until the process is concluded.  In the interim, if you receive a request from the public for an FDS of a newly elected or appointed local government officer, we recommend the LGO be given an opportunity to fill out an old 2012 FDS form and make it available to share with the requestor.  Such forms shall not be filed with the Local Finance Board and they will not replace the LGO's obligation to complete an official FDS form once the online filing process is available.

However, responding in such a manner to requests from the public will obviate disputes with members of the public while the 2014 process is being finalized and it will help further public confidence in their officials.
